Small Business and HR Compliance dates this week:

July 25, 2022

National Hire a Veteran Day. This day was set to raise awareness of civilian employment for Veterans after their military service.

July 28, 2022

National Intern Day. Celebrate your interns and all of the hard work that they do!

July 31, 2022

IRS Deadlines. All due today: Quarterly Federal Excise Tax Return (Form 720); FUTA payments for Q2 (Form 940); Employer’s Quarterly Federal Tax Return (Form 941) for Q2.

PCORI Payment Due. This payment is for Patient-Centered Outcomes Research Institute (PCORI) fees for the plan year that ended in 2020.

How Learning and Development Is Getting Companies Through the Great Resignation

The Great Resignation has created a retention issue for companies big and small. The good news is, by providing career development opportunities, companies can connect skill-building to internal career paths and boost retention in the process.

In fact, LinkedIn found that “companies that excel at internal mobility retain employees for an average of 5.4 years.” That’s nearly twice as long as companies that struggle with learning and development. Pay Stub Requirements By State

You pay your employees on time. But do you give them a pay stub as well? Providing pay stubs is not only good business practice but also legally required in most states. Also called a “wage statement,” a pay stub breaks down an employee’s gross-to-net wages for the covered pay period. It is basically a receipt (given to the employee) for the wages paid.
